Production of Petroleum Coke
Petroleum coke is a product during the process of refining crude oil. Crude oil undergoes steps such as coking, in which it breaks down into lower molecular weight components(e.g.50-200); the cracking occurs at high temperature above 380 and without presence of oxygen present. The process separates the lighter hydrocarbons from heavier residues and leaves petcoke in its final form.
The major stages involved in the production of Petcoke are:
Delayed Coking: This includes vaporizing the heavy residual oils at high temperatures within a coker unit. The process of coking sees large hydrocarbon molecules by an independent, produces petcoke and a variety of other products.
Fluid Coking: In this process, the heavy oil is cracked into lighter products and petcoke by fluidized bed reactor. It works at higher temperatures than the delayed coking.
Flexicoking: an upgrade from the fluid coker that includes gasification to convert petcoke into a synthetic gas (syngas) making it possible for more efficient usage of this process.
Properties OF Petroleum Coke
The physical and chemical characteristics of petroleum coke depend on the type of crude oil from which it is derived and upon what specific refining process is used. Key properties include:
Carbon - High carbon (often greater than 90%) which means a lot of energy.
Typical Typical Miniumum Maximum Sulfur Content: wide range of values, from low sulfur content (anode-grade) to high sulfur content (fuel-grade).
Porosity: Porous in structure, which determine reactivity and lab use
Hardness: Difficult and brittle, which can affect its workability.

Needle Coke:
Attributes: Very high crystallinity, minimal sulfur and nitrogen
Uses: Essential in the production of graphite electrodes for electric arc furnaces, crucial to the steelmaking process.
Catalyst Coke:
Characteristics: Coked structure Results from catalytic cracking applications; often highly porous.
Application: Mainly used in gasification and as feedstock for the chemical industry.

Benefits of Petroleum Coke
Advantages of petroleum coke utilisation
Cost: Petcoke is frequently priced lower than competitive alternatives like coal and natural gas, making it an attractive option for many industries from a financial perspective.
High Carbon Content: Petcoke holds a large amount of carbon per unit, it is highly energy-dense leading to higher efficiency as fuel.
Flexibility: Petcoke can be adapted to meet the unique requirements of industrial applicationsas it comes in various grades.
By-Product: Petcoke is a by-product of the refining process, and therefore more consistently available than other fuel sources.
